Vast crowd sees Romero beatified as a martyr and hero of the poor
http://www.cruxnow.com/church/2015/05/23/vast-crowd-sees-romero-beatified-as-a-martyr-and-hero-of-the-poor/
In a Saturday ceremony believed to mark the largest religious
gathering in the history of Central America, the late Archbishop Oscar
Romero, killed in 1980 for defending the poor and victims of human
rights abuses in El Salvador, was declared a "blessed" of the Catholic
Church.

Cardinal Tagle will be a force in Catholicism for a long time
http://www.cruxnow.com/church/2015/05/15/cardinal-tagle-force-catholic-charities/
The Irish betting firm Paddy Power has Cardinal Luis Antonio Tagle of
the Philippines as the favorite to be the next pope, giving him 11/2
odds. Already dubbed the "Asian Francis," Tagle got another boost this
week with his election to lead a global federation of Catholic
charities. Between today and whenever a conclave might occur, any
number of things can happen to change the landscape. That dose of
caution, however, rarely stops "next pope" rumors from being the
Church's favorite parlor game. So if we're going to go down that
route, there's a great deal to be said for Tagle, who would make a
strong runner if the key issue next time is continuity with Francis...

Sister Noelene Makes a Habit of Sustainable Development
Radio NZ. Country Life (text and audio)
http://www.radionz.co.nz/national/programmes/countrylife
Sister Noelene lives at Mount St Joseph in Whanganui and says if the
world wants to survive it has to have a different view of God. "He's
in the earth, other people, other religions, all life ... our only
hope for the future of planet earth is .... a spirituality that
accepts everyone and everything and looks after it with the dignity it
deserves." With those sorts of thoughts it's not surprising that when
Sister Noelene returned to St Joseph in 2003, where she was a
novitiate in the 1960's, she looked at the five hectare property with
new eyes and saw potential ...

150 years of news: Pope's visit to Wellington blustery with little fuss (photo)
http://www.stuff.co.nz/dominion-post/news/67556531/Pope-gave-sick-and-dying-special-anointment
It was wind rather than controversy which plagued Pope John Paul II's
visit to Wellington in 1986. A crowd of about 25,000 at Athletic Park
were buffeted by the breeze as the 66-year-old pontiff celebrated mass
at the rugby ground on November 23, 1986.
